    When people use text colors without realizing that they may have just made their text unreadable. This includes forcing your text color to black or white.

    I should never have to highlight your text, and all users should realize that there's always some theme your chosen text color is going to be difficult to read in, and plan accordingly; especially in CSS box situations where there's a background specified but not a text color forced for readability.

    If you plan your color choices carefully, you can avoid having an unreadable post. Just be sure to check your font against a few of the dark and light themes and make sure the choice you've made doesn't become unreadable. Usually Yellow, White, Grey, Lime, Purple, and Black are the most common offenders of being difficult to read. It's normally a good idea to preview your post and check against another theme after clicking the preview button if you're concerned that the text color you picked might be the background in another theme. Believe me; PC has a lot of themes, so figuring this out before settling on a color is usually a good idea if you're theming your text color too.
